JavaScript 縮小器
使用專業級縮小功能壓縮和優化您的 JavaScript 代碼。減小檔案大小、縮短載入時間並提高 Web 應用程式的性能。
縮小選項
原始大小
0 KB
縮小尺寸
0 KB
尺寸減小
0%
Load Time
0% faster
關於 JavaScript 縮小器
什麼是 JavaScript 縮小器?
JavaScript 縮小器是一個強大的工具,可以壓縮和優化您的 JavaScript 代碼,在不影響功能的情況下減小其檔大小。通過刪除不必要的空格、註釋和縮短變數名稱,您的代碼會變得更小,載入速度更快。
對於希望提高網站性能、減少頻寬使用和增強用戶體驗的 Web 開發人員來說,該工具是必不可少的。
為什麼要縮小 JavaScript?
- 更快的載入時間:較小的檔案大小意味著您的用戶下載速度更快。
- 減少頻寬:為您和您的使用者節省資料傳輸成本。
- 改進的 SEO:頁面速度是搜尋引擎演算法中的一個排名因素。
- 代碼保護:縮小的代碼更難進行逆向工程和複製。
- 更好的快取:瀏覽器快取較小的檔效率更高。
縮小前
// Example JavaScript code function factorial(n) { if (n === 0 || n === 1) { return 1; } else { return n * factorial(n - 1); } } // Fibonacci sequence generator function fibonacci(n) { if (n <= 1) { return n; } else { return fibonacci(n - 1) + fibonacci(n - 2); } } // Array sum function function sumArray(arr) { return arr.reduce((sum, num) => sum + num, 0); } // Class example class Calculator { constructor() { this.history = []; } add(a, b) { const result = a + b; this.history.push(\`Added \${a} and \${b} to get \${result}\`); return result; } subtract(a, b) { const result = a - b; this.history.push(\`Subtracted \${b} from \${a} to get \${result}\`); return result; } getHistory() { return this.history; } }
縮小後
function factorial(n){return n===0||n===1?1:n*factorial(n-1)}function fibonacci(n){return n<=1?n:fibonacci(n-1)+fibonacci(n-2)}function sumArray(arr){return arr.reduce((sum,num)=>sum+num,0)}class Calculator{constructor(){this.history=[]}add(a,b){const result=a+b;this.history.push(\`Added \${a} and \${b} to get \${result}\`);return result}subtract(a,b){const result=a-b;this.history.push(\`Subtracted \${b} from \${a} to get \${result}\`);return result}getHistory(){return this.history}}